Definition and Meaning

A printable attendance record is a document used to track and record the attendance of individuals, typically in educational, corporate, or organizational settings. It serves as an official log that captures who was present or absent on specific dates, and often details reasons for absences if provided. This form is designed for ease of use when printing and can be filled out manually or digitally to maintain accurate records. Keeping an organized attendance record can aid in identifying patterns, ensuring compliance with rules, and facilitating administrative tasks.

How to Use the Printable Attendance Record

To effectively use a printable attendance record, start by determining the specific details you need to capture, such as participant names, dates, presence or absence status, and any relevant remarks. Follow these steps:

  1. Prepare the Form: Ensure the attendance record template is printed and ready for use, or access it digitally if using an electronic version.
  2. Register Participants: List all participating individuals in a designated column or section.
  3. Mark Attendance: Record attendance by marking present, absent, or tardy for each date/session. Utilize checkboxes or other indicators for clarity.
  4. Add Notes: Include any relevant remarks or explanations for absences in the notes section, if applicable.
  5. Review and Secure: Periodically review the records for accuracy and keep them securely stored for reference or compliance purposes.

Key Elements of the Printable Attendance Record

A comprehensive printable attendance record includes various elements that ensure it serves its intended purpose effectively:

  • Header Information: Title, date range, and organization or class name.
  • Participant List: Names of individuals whose attendance is being tracked.
  • Date Columns: Each session or date during which attendance is recorded.
  • Attendance Indicators: Symbols or fields to indicate presence, absence, or tardiness.
  • Notes Section: Space for additional comments or specific reasons for absences.
  • Signature Lines: Optional lines for instructor or supervisor verification.

Who Typically Uses the Printable Attendance Record

Printable attendance records are commonly utilized by:

  • Educational Institutions: Teachers and administrators track student attendance for compliance with educational requirements.
  • Businesses: Employers monitor employee attendance to manage human resources efficiently.
  • Event Organizers: Coordinators track participant engagement and turnout at meetings, seminars, or workshops.
  • Nonprofit Organizations: Volunteer coordinators log volunteer hours and participation for record-keeping and reporting purposes.

Digital vs. Paper Version

Comparing digital and paper versions of the printable attendance record offers insights into their respective advantages:

  • Digital Advantages:

    • Easily shareable and updatable in real-time.
    • Automated calculation of attendance rates and trends.
    • Eco-friendly, eliminating the need for physical storage.
    • Software integration, allowing for seamless data manipulation.
  • Paper Advantages:

    • Traditional and straightforward for those less tech-savvy.
    • No requirement for electronic devices or internet access.
    • Tangible and easier for physical audits.

Legal Use of the Printable Attendance Record

Maintaining a legal and compliant attendance record involves several considerations:

  • Confidentiality: Ensure that attendance records are handled with confidentiality, especially in educational or HR settings where privacy laws may apply.
  • Accurate Reporting: Records must accurately reflect attendance to avoid legal ramifications, such as disputes over employment or educational participation.
  • Retention Policies: Adhere to organizational or legal guidelines on the retention of attendance records, which may vary by state or industry.

How to create an attendance sheet in Excel Step 1: Create columns for each date for a month. Step 2: Add names in the first column. Step 3: Color-fill columns for weekends and holidays. Step 4: Set inputs using Data Validation. Step 5: Create a function to calculate the presence and absence. Step 6: Add the final details.
